Is bengali language eligible for linguistic minority in any college for neet

Pragya sarwaiya 16th Jan, 2022

Hi

There is no linguistic quota for West Bengal for now

It is applicable in Karnataka for minorities who speak Tamil, Telugu, Tulu or kodava. These are the languages spoken in Karnataka alongwith their native language.

Cut-offs changes from year to year and depends on many factors like

* Number of seats available.

* Difficulty level of the exam.

* Number of students appeared in the exam.

* Caste Category of the students, etc.
